Web1412: ·Joan of Arc born and baptized in Domremy 1425: ·Joan begins to hear voices 1428: ·Joan travels to Vaucouleurs (prompted by voices), and asks to join the Dauphin but is turned away. 1429: ·Joan journeys again to Vaucouleurs to ask to join the Dauphin's forces; this time she is accepted. At the beginning, Jeanne (Joan) … WebMar 10, 2024 · Joan of Arc didn’t set out to become a martyr. But as the teenage French warrior faced death at the hands of her persecutors in the English-occupied town of Rouen, France on May 30, 1431, she surely came to accept that unenviable honor.
